So........ the anemone is bleached. there are no healthy bubble tips that are white. did you buy it this color? low no3 won't necessarily bleach an anemones ,but high no3 and/or po4 could cause it to become unhealthy in several ways. stop trying to feed it, don't touch it, just get your po4 down. it's not dead......yet and it can be saved.
